BACKGROUND:
This resolution will give approval of the Hideaway Beach Special Taxing District Budget predicated on a fiscal year 2024 millage of 1.6000.
Section 200.065, Florida Statutes, governs the budget adoption process. The Truth in Millage (“TRIM”) statute establishes a detailed timeline and approval process that includes requiring two public hearings held in the month of September and a separate resolution for approval of the annual budget. To comply with the TRIM regulations, City Council is required to take separate actions in a specified order. At the public hearing, the public may speak and ask questions before the Council adopts any measures. Then, before Council adopts a budget, it must first have adopted a millage rate.
FUNDING SOURCE / FISCAL IMPACT: The fiscal year 2024 budget is presented in balance.
RECOMMENDATION: Conduct the public hearings required by TRIM regulations and approve the resolution finally adopting the budget. The tax levy for the Hideaway Beach Special Taxing District is consistent with voter referendum approval of the District and is required to finance the District’s beach projects.
